NATURE WALK, DEC. 17
Santa Rosa: Naturalists lead free one-hour family nature hikes at Spring Lake Regional Park at 1 and 3 p.m. Saturday, followed by nature themed crafts and exploration of the touchable tide pool. Meet at the Environmental Discovery Center, 393 Violetti Road. $7 parking, bring a water bottle and wear sturdy shoes. Heavy rain cancels the event. TREE EXPLORATION, DEC. 17
Healdsburg: Learn about the 15 most common tree species at Modini Mayacamas Preserves and how they survive fire during a leisurely 3-mile guided walk from 9 a.m. to noon Saturday. Bring water and a lunch. Meet at Pine Flat Road and Red Winery Road. The event may be canceled by 8 p.m. the night before due to weather. Check at meetup.com/Friends-of-the-Modini-Mayacamas. SOLSTICE CELEBRATION, DEC. 21
Santa Rosa: Celebrate the Winter Solstice 1-5 p.m. Wednesday at Spring Lake Regional Park’s Environmental Discovery Center, 393 Violetti Road. Create spiral art and solar prints and hike to Frog Pond to see winter residents like California newts. $7 parking. Visit parks.sonomacounty.ca.gov for information or call 707-539-2865.
